On 11/14/23 07:12, Andrew Burgess wrote:
>> diff --git a/gdb/gdbarch-gen.h b/gdb/gdbarch-gen.h
>> index c2de274ed2a9..3160aa8a9613 100644
>> --- a/gdb/gdbarch-gen.h
>> +++ b/gdb/gdbarch-gen.h
>> @@ -200,11 +200,18 @@ typedef struct value * (gdbarch_pseudo_register_read_value_ftype) (struct gdbarc
>>  extern struct value * gdbarch_pseudo_register_read_value (struct gdbarch *gdbarch, frame_info_ptr next_frame, int cookednum);
>>  extern void set_gdbarch_pseudo_register_read_value (struct gdbarch *gdbarch, gdbarch_pseudo_register_read_value_ftype *pseudo_register_read_value);
>>  
>> -extern bool gdbarch_pseudo_register_write_p (struct gdbarch *gdbarch);
>> +/* Write bytes to a pseudo register.
>>  
>> -typedef void (gdbarch_pseudo_register_write_ftype) (struct gdbarch *gdbarch, struct regcache *regcache, int cookednum, const gdb_byte *buf);
>> -extern void gdbarch_pseudo_register_write (struct gdbarch *gdbarch, struct regcache *regcache, int cookednum, const gdb_byte *buf);
>> -extern void set_gdbarch_pseudo_register_write (struct gdbarch *gdbarch, gdbarch_pseudo_register_write_ftype *pseudo_register_write);
>> +   This is marked as deprecated because it gets passed a regcache for
>> +   implementations to write raw registers in.  This doesn't work for unwound
>> +   frames, where the raw registers backing the pseudo registers may have been
>> +   saved elsewhere. */
> 
> Missing a space before '*/' here.
> 
> Thanks,
> Andrew

Hmm, this is in gdbarch-gen.h, so this is due to how gdbarch.py does
things.

Simon
